list-multipart-uploads

更新时间:2025-04-02 06:10:33

list-multipart-uploads用于列举所有执行中的Multipart Upload事件。

注意事项

调用list-multipart-uploads命令列举所有执行中的Multipart Upload事件指已经初始化但还未完成(Complete)或者还未中止(Abort)的Multipart Upload事件。

权限说明

阿里云账号默认拥有全部权限。阿里云账号下的RAM用户或RAM角色默认没有任何权限,需要阿里云账号或账号管理员通过RAM PolicyBucket Policy授予操作权限。

API

Action

说明

API

Action

说明

ListMultipartUploads

oss:ListMultipartUploads

列举所有执行中的Multipart Upload事件,即已经初始化但尚未完成(Complete)或者尚未中止(Abort)的Multipart Upload事件。

命令格式

ossutil api list-multipart-uploads --bucket value [flags]
说明

list-multipart-uploads命令对应API接口ListMultipartUploads。关于API中的具体参数含义,请参见ListMultipartUploads

参数

类型

说明

参数

类型

说明

--bucket

string

Bucket名称。

--delimiter

string

Object名字进行分组的字符。

--encoding-type

string

对返回的内容进行编码并指定编码的类型。

--max-uploads

int

返回的最大Upload个数。

--prefix

string

限定返回的Object Key必须以prefix作为前缀。

--upload-id-marker

string

key-marker参数配合使用,用于指定返回结果的起始位置。

  • 如果未设置key-marker参数,则OSS会忽略upload-id-marker参数。

  • 如果设置了key-marker参数,查询结果中包含:

    • 所有Object名称的字典序大于key-marker参数值的Multipart Upload事件。

    • Object名称等于key-marker参数值,但是UploadIdupload-id-marker参数值大的Multipart Upload事件。

--key-marker

string

upload-id-marker参数配合使用,用于指定返回结果的起始位置。

  • 如果未设置upload-id-marker参数,查询结果中包含所有Object名称的字典序大于key-marker参数值的Multipart Upload事件。

  • 如果设置了upload-id-marker参数,查询结果中包含:

    • 所有Object名称的字典序大于key-marker参数值的Multipart Upload事件。

    • Object名称等于key-marker参数值,但是UploadIdupload-id-marker参数值大的Multipart Upload事件。

说明

关于支持的全局命令行选项,请参见支持的全局命令行选项

使用示例

  • 列举目标存储空间examplebucket所有正在执行的Multipart Upload事件。

    ossutil api list-multipart-uploads --bucket examplebucket
  • 列举目标存储空间examplebucket所有正在执行的Multipart Upload事件,以JSON格式显示。

    ossutil api list-multipart-uploads --bucket examplebucket --output-format json
  • 列举目标存储空间examplebucket所有正在执行的Multipart Upload事件,以YAML格式显示。

    ossutil api list-multipart-uploads --bucket examplebucket --output-format yaml
  • 列举目标存储空间examplebucket中指定前缀下dir下的Multipart Upload事件。

    ossutil api list-multipart-uploads --bucket examplebucket --prefix dir
  • 列举目标存储空间examplebucket中前100Multipart Upload事件。

    ossutil api list-multipart-uploads --bucket examplebucket --max-uploads 100
  • 列举目标存储空间examplebucket中根目录下的Multipart Upload事件。

    ossutil api list-multipart-uploads --bucket examplebucket --delimiter /
  • 列举目标存储空间examplebucket中从test.txt之后按字母排序返回的Multipart Upload事件。

    ossutil api list-multipart-uploads --bucket examplebucket --key-marker test.txt
  • 列举目标存储空间examplebucket中所有 Multipart Upload事件,并对对象名字进行URL编码。

    ossutil api list-multipart-uploads --bucket examplebucket --encoding-type url
  • 本页导读 (1)
  • 注意事项
  • 权限说明
  • 命令格式
  • 使用示例